arrayObject.push(newelement1,newelement2,....,newelementX)
nemelement1為必須,其他為可選。
把指定的值添加到數組后的新長度。返回值
push() 方法可把它的參數順序添加到 arrayObject 的尾部。它直接修改 arrayObject,而不是創建一個新的數組。push() 方法和 pop() 方法使用數組提供的先進后出棧的功能。
測試
<script type="text/javascript"> var arr = new Array(3) arr[0] = "Jason" arr[1] = "John" arr[2] = "Jimi" document.write(arr + "<br />") document.write(arr.push("James") + "<br />") document.write(arr) </script>
輸出:
Jason,John,Jimi 4
Jason,John,Jimi,James
要想數組的開頭添加一個或多個元素,請使用 unshift() 方法。